SHRUB OAK, NY — Christmas spirit was on display early in Yorktown when two members of the world-renowned Radio City Rockettes came to the John C. Hart Memorial Library Sept. 26.

The Rockettes took time off from rehearsing for the 2019 Christmas Spectacular by visiting libraries during the month for festive arts and crafts sessions with fans and families.

Children and their families were able to take photos with the Rockettes which were instantly printed and framed inside a snow globe.

The Rockettes joined the local children in decorating their snow globes to create a memorable keepsake.

The 2019 Christmas Spectacular production features Rockettes dance numbers, costumes and immersive technology and visual effects.

The finale, "Christmas Lights," begins at the conclusion of the "Living Nativity" scene, which has been performed as part of the Christmas Spectacular since its inception in 1933.
